Fiery, filling and comforting – exactly what a good curry should be, and exactly what they are at this popular Karama joint, which has a barbecue station on the street and booth-style seating inside.
There are a couple of standout dishes on the menu, which boasts a good array of Punjabi classics like dahl makhani – stewed for hours overnight, and the chicken handi.
Meals are served up with lightening speed and plonked on the table with little fanfare along with slightly oily naan, but you’ll be too busy gobbling down the spicy goodness to pay attention. If it’s too spicy, down it with a sweet or salty lassi or carrot juice, and breathe deeply.
